What is community service recordbook entry

The Community Service Recordbook Entry Form is a government form used by VFW posts to submit community service recordbooks for judging in the State Community Service Recordbook Contest.

Key Features of the Community Service Recordbook Entry Form

This form encompasses several key components essential for accurate completion, including:
  • Post number
  • City and state
  • City population
  • Totals for various projects
  • Sections for judges' notes and Post Commander signature
These features ensure that all necessary information is captured to reflect the community service efforts effectively.

Eligibility to use the Community Service Recordbook Entry Form typically includes Post Commanders, VFW members, and those responsible for community service projects within VFW posts.
Yes, submissions must be made by the specified deadline of the State Community Service Recordbook Contest. Check with your local VFW branch for exact dates.
The completed Community Service Recordbook Entry Form can be submitted either by physically attaching it to the recordbook or via electronic submission, depending on guidance from your VFW department headquarters.
Typically, no additional supporting documents are required with the Community Service Recordbook Entry Form, but ensure to attach it to the recordbook as per the instructions provided.
Common mistakes include leaving required fields blank, providing incorrect post information, and failing to obtain the necessary signature from the Post Commander.
